Job Description Introduction Winters Chapel Animal Hospital is a privately owned hospital that primarily treats cats and dogs. The team is open and supportive of veterinarians with interests in less common species, such as avian medicine. They are currently seeking an experienced Associate Veterinarian to join their growing team as the third doctor in the practice. Working Hours / Rota We are looking for a full time associate veterinarian. For full-time doctors, the schedule runs Monday to Friday, 9:00 am to 5:00 pm, with Saturday shifts on rotation, 9am-1pm. Role Description and Responsibilities The Associate Veterinarian's day typically includes a mix of surgeries (if applicable) and 30-minute appointments. Clinical responsibilities span general practice services such as surgery, dentistry, dermatology, geriatrics, internal medicine, nutrition, behaviour, allergy management, and diagnostics. This position is available to experienced veterinarians only. Surgery is negotiable. Benefits Package Flexible Compensation Package Health cover Simple IRA 2 weeks PTO CE allowance Relocation assistance to be negotiated Licenses and Dues Pet discount No negative accrual No non-compete Continued Mentorship Opportunities Practice Details The hospital is equipped with x-ray, in-house blood machines, in-house urinalysis, a wet table, a dedicated surgery room, anaesthesia and oxygen equipment, and paperless medical records. They also partner with a travelling ultrasonographer, eliminating the need for in-house ultrasound. Although we do have a handheld ultrasound for quick scans. As an independent practice, they offer personalized support and flexible career development paths, actively encouraging doctors to introduce new ideas and areas of interest. Team The practice currently has two doctors, with this position expanding the team to three. They are supported by a capable team of support staff, and the environment is collaborative and adaptable, with a strong focus on supporting individual professional goals.
